Infants get every part: free meals, plenty of consideration, near-universal acclaim. And now, they get a characteristic I have been on the lookout for from area heaters ever since I began testing them.
Most area heaters have an issue so apparent it ought to really feel embarrassing to everybody concerned. Cashiers ought to say, “I’m sorry,” as they take the cash. Prospects ought to really feel ashamed as they fork it over. The issue is that this: The thermostat used to control the machine is situated contained in the area heater, typically inside inches of a very popular heating ingredient. This doesn’t result in good outcomes.
Apparently it took a child to resolve the issue. Or not less than, it took an area heater made for infants. The Sensa Cribside, from Vornado’s child line of heaters and followers, is the primary ceramic area heater I’ve examined that comes with a separate, exterior temperature sensor. And so the room temperature registered by the heater is the precise temperature within the room—on this case, proper by the crib the place the infant sleeps.

The Sensa, like another Vornado area heaters that rank amongst our picks for one of the best area heaters round, is a fairly good area heater. It is splendidly quiet, and Vornado’s “vortex” know-how—mainly a fan rotating right into a spiral of plastic that is oriented the other approach—tends to maneuver sizzling air silently and evenly, with solely the barest breeze. My decibel meter barely budged past ranges denoted “background noise.”
However the true mind-blower is that the sensor is correct. The temperature measured by Sensa’s distant sensor stayed inside a level of the temperature measured by a digital thermometer positioned proper subsequent to it, a vanishingly uncommon high quality amongst dozens of transportable area heaters I’ve examined. When the room temperature reached the prescribed level, the Sensa slowed its roll, then switched to a fan. Holy cow: a practical space-heater thermostat.
I regarded in useless, and no different Vornado heater gives an exterior sensor like this. Solely the Sensa, for infants. Infants get every part.

Heaters for Tots
On this notice, caveats are so as. Area heater security has improved significantly over the a long time, and this Sensa accommodates much more fail-safes than most. For as lengthy as they maintain their jobs, your useful federal client security consultants do warn in opposition to leaving an area heater unattended in a child’s room.
Sensa’s thermostat works nicely, and the machine additionally boasts a programmable shutoff timer so it will not run indefinitely. However the danger of hyperthermia is actual.
